HEGERLS Warehouse Control System (WCS) serves as the intelligent execution layer between warehouse management software and automation equipment. It coordinates material handling systems in real time, optimizes task execution, and maximizes equipment utilization through intelligent scheduling and dynamic path planning.
HEGERLS YUNTU-WCS (Warehouse Control System) is an intelligent warehouse execution platform that bridges the gap between WMS and warehouse automation equipment. It centrally coordinates and controls multiple automation systems—including four-way shuttles, stacker cranes, AGVs, elevators, and conveyor systems—to ensure efficient, synchronized warehouse operations.
Powered by intelligent scheduling and dynamic path planning algorithms, YUNTU-WCS optimizes task allocation, vehicle routing, and equipment collaboration in real time. Combined with an interactive 2D/3D warehouse visualization platform, OpenAPI integration, and seamless connectivity with WMS, ERP, and PLC systems, it enables high-performance warehouse automation with maximum efficiency, reliability, and scalability.

Record and replay warehouse operations to simplify troubleshooting and process optimization.
Store up to 7 days of task history
Replay completed tasks step by step
Trace automatic task execution
Analyze historical operations and equipment performance
Quickly identify abnormal events

Automatically detect, diagnose, and recover from equipment or task abnormalities to maintain uninterrupted warehouse operations.
Automatic recovery for more than 90% of abnormal tasks
Intelligent recovery strategy matching
Real-time alarm notifications
Visual alarm locations displayed on warehouse maps
Detailed fault descriptions and recommended solutions
Event logging and traceability

HEGERLS follows a standardized implementation methodology to ensure every software project is delivered efficiently, integrated seamlessly, and operates reliably from day one.
Conduct on-site surveys, analyze business processes, and define functional requirements to establish clear project objectives.
Design the overall software architecture, workflow, and system integration strategy based on operational requirements.
Develop, configure, and customize the WMS/WCS platform, including interfaces with ERP, MES, PLC, and warehouse automation equipment.
Perform comprehensive functional testing, system integration testing, and performance validation to ensure stable and reliable operation.
Provide user training for operators, administrators, and maintenance teams before supporting a smooth system launch.
Deliver ongoing technical support, software upgrades, preventive maintenance, and system optimization to ensure long-term operational performance.
